The invention mainly relates to the field of launching of aircrafts such as airships, airplanes and rockets. The invention mainly aims to solve the problem of launching the aircrafts such as the airships, the airplanes and the airships in the air. The modern aircrafts take off from the ground surface, energy is consumed when the modern aircrafts reach tens of thousands of meters in the air, but the loss can be effectively reduced when the modern aircrafts are launched in the air. For the rockets, fuel consumption required by lift-off can be effectively reduced, namely a third-stage rocket anda second-stage rocket are added, and the effective load is greatly improved. The modern aircrafts can be launched at any place in the world, the platform can serve as a mobile launching site, and a launching task can be executed at the optimal position. A rocket can even be assembled from a rocket manufacturing plant, and then is transported by the platform, so that the problem of difficulty in land transportation between launching sites is solved. An air aircraft command center can be established by the platform, or the platform becomes an air carrier.
